
A growing number of users are reporting issues with their Crypto.com accounts, finding potentially erroneous account balances after purchasing the CRO token. With both confusion and concern rising, some users aim to figure out if itβs a technical issue or a simple mistake made while trading.
Many users have hit forums recently to share their experiences regarding odd activity in their Crypto.com accounts. One user claimed they bought CRO only to discover a repeat of the purchase reflected in their app without any money being deducted from their bank.

Interestingly, one comment revealed, "Okay I figured out what happened. I accidentally put on reoccurring buy, I didnβt notice it yesterday but money was taken from my account." This indicates some users may be experiencing issues not due to the platform but due to user oversight.
